Transaction 1097212c90caf53ddaf321ed202d38334132c5eb58d54a008b53186c99a0b86d
1 Input
1 Output
-
1097212c90caf53ddaf321ed202d38334132c5eb58d54a008b53186c99a0b86d:0
- value
- 10780
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 80366dd0095acbdfaec4d5e56e4729c784874281e8450263ffa1c13f66bb5b66
- address
- tb1psqmxm5qftt9altky6hjku3efc7zgws5papzsycll58qn7e4mtdnqt970hj